Background
Water pumps are machines that deliver or pressurize a liquid. It transfers the mechanical energy of prime mover or other external energy to liquid to increase the energy of liquid, and is mainly used to transfer liquid including water, oil, acid-base liquid, emulsion, suspoemulsion and liquid metal.
Liquids, gas mixtures, and liquids containing suspended solids may also be transported. The technical parameters of the water pump performance include flow, suction lift, shaft power, water power, efficiency and the like; the pump can be divided into a volume water pump, a vane pump and the like according to different working principles. The displacement pump transfers energy by utilizing the change of the volume of a working chamber; vane pumps transfer energy by the interaction of rotating vanes with water and are available in the types of centrifugal pumps, axial flow pumps, mixed flow pumps, and the like.

Referring to fig. 1-2, the present invention provides a technical solution: the utility model provides a water pump case inside wall waste material clearing device, includes work frame 1 and props leg 2, its characterized in that: the support legs 2 are provided with four groups, and the four groups of support legs 2 are fixedly connected to the bottom of the working frame 1 in an array manner, two groups of symmetrical side plates 3 are fixedly connected to the front side wall and the rear side wall of the inner cavity of the working frame 1, the side, close to each other, of each of the two groups of side plates 3 is provided with an upper chute 4 and a lower chute 5, an upper slide block 6 and a lower slide block 7 are respectively connected in the upper chute 4 and the lower chute 5 in a sliding manner, a transverse moving platform 8 is fixedly connected between the two groups of upper slide blocks 6, a cross rod port 9 is formed in the transverse moving platform 8, an inner thread block 10 is fixedly connected in the cross rod port 9, a material collecting box 11 is fixedly connected to the top of the transverse moving platform 8, a suction fan 12 and a discharge pipe 13 are respectively connected to the top and the right side wall of the material collecting box 11, a material guide platform 14 is fixedly connected to the bottom of the inner cavity of the material collecting box 11, two groups of symmetrical material suction pipes 15 are communicated, a mounting plate 16 is fixedly connected between the two groups of lower slide blocks 7, four groups of elastic assemblies 17 are fixedly connected between the top of the mounting plate 16 and the transverse moving platform 8, the cleaning motor 18 is arranged on the mounting plate 16, a cleaning rotating rod 19 is fixedly connected to the bottom power output end of the cleaning motor 18, cleaning bristles 20 are fixedly connected to the cleaning rotating rod 19, the displacement motor 21 is arranged on the top of the working frame 1, a reciprocating lead screw 22 is fixedly connected to the left power output end of the displacement motor 21, the reciprocating lead screw 22 is connected with the working frame 1 through a bearing seat, and the reciprocating lead screw 22 is in threaded connection with the internal thread block 10.
Further, the lower chute 5 is arc-shaped, so that the inner wall of the water pump shell with the same arc shape can be cleaned conveniently, and the inner wall is cleaned by the cleaning bristles 20.
Furthermore, the material suction pipes 15 penetrate through the working frame 1 and are located on the rear side of the reciprocating screw rod 22, and the bottom of the material suction pipes 15 is higher than the bottom of the cleaning bristles 20, so that the two groups of material suction pipes 15 can conveniently absorb the cleaned debris.
Further, the guide table 14 is tapered to facilitate guiding the chips.
Furthermore, the reciprocating screw rod 22 penetrates through the rod opening 9, so that the transverse moving table 8 is driven to reciprocate left and right.
One specific application of this embodiment is: the invention is suitable for cleaning scraps attached to the inner side wall of a water pump shell, in particular to a waste cleaning device for the inner side wall of the water pump shell, when in use, the device is placed and fixed, then an inner cavity of the semi-water pump shell to be cleaned is upwards moved and fixed under the device, a cleaning rotating rod 19 is inserted in the inner cavity of the water pump shell, the arc shape of the water pump shell is the same as the shape of a lower chute 5, cleaning bristles 20 are abutted against the inner side wall of the water pump shell, then a cleaning motor 18 and a displacement motor 21 are started, the cleaning motor 18 drives the cleaning rotating rod 19 and the cleaning bristles 20 to rotate, the cleaning bristles 20 clean the waste on the inner side wall of the water pump shell, then the displacement motor 21 drives a reciprocating screw rod 22 to rotate, the reciprocating screw rod 22 is in threaded connection with an internal thread block 10, the internal thread block 10 drives a transverse moving platform 8 to move left and right, the transverse platform 8 drives a mounting plate 16 to move left and right through an elastic component 17, meanwhile, the upper chute 4 is horizontal, and the lower chute 5 is arc-shaped, so that the elastic assembly 17 is stretched, the cleaning bristles 20 clean the inner side wall of the water pump shell, the suction fan 12 is started, waste materials cleaned in the water pump shell are absorbed through the two groups of material suction pipes 15 and are sucked into the material collection box 11, and the material guide table 14 guides the waste materials and discharges the waste materials through the material discharge pipe 13.
